Ukraine increases gas transit by one third in Jan-May

Ukraine in January-May 2016 increased transit of natural gas to Europe and Moldova by 34.3% (by 8.001 billion cubic meters), compared to the same period in 2015, to 31.361 billion cubic meters.

According to live data from PJSC Ukrtransgaz, transit to Europe in January-May this year amounted to 30.064 billion cubic meters, to Moldova 1.298 billion cubic meters.

In May 2016 transit of gas to Europe and Moldova increased by 20% (by 1.078 billion cubic meters) compared to May 2015, to 6.468 billion cubic meters. In particular transit of gas through Ukraine to Europe amounted to 6.296 billion cubic meters, to Moldova 172 million cubic meters.

As reported, Gazprom in September 2014-February 2015 restricted gas supplies to Europe through Ukraine. Restrictions were introduced to counter reverse shipments from the EU to Ukraine.
